Double Wide Demolition in Bergen County, NJ
Double wide demolition services involve the removal of large manufactured homes, typically spanning two sections or more, from residential properties. This type of demolition covers projects where homeowners need to clear space for new construction, renovations, or property improvements. Property owners should consider factors such as the size of the structure, accessibility of the site, and any associated utilities or permits required before requesting this service. Understanding the scope of the project helps ensure proper planning and compliance with local regulations.
When requesting double wide demolition, property owners usually want to know about the process involved, including site preparation, debris removal, and any necessary permits. It is also important to clarify what will happen to the site afterward, such as grading or preparation for new development. Having a clear understanding of these aspects can facilitate a smoother demolition process and help coordinate subsequent construction or landscaping efforts.

Double Wide Demolition Questions
What is involved in double wide demolition? The process includes safely removing the entire structure, including foundation and debris clearance, to prepare the site for future use.
What types of properties require double wide demolition? This service is typically used for manufactured homes, large mobile homes, or similar structures that span a wide area.
Are there specific permits needed for double wide demolition? Local regulations may require permits; property owners should check with municipal authorities before proceeding.
What should property owners consider before a double wide demolition? It's important to evaluate site access, utility disconnections, and future plans for the cleared land.
